    Ingredients Needed

    Gather the following ingredients to prepare beef pinwheels that are flavorful and satisfying.

    Essential Ingredients

    • Beef: Use flank steak or sirloin, about 1 to 1.5 pounds, thinly sliced to allow easy rolling.
    • Cream Cheese: About 4 ounces for a creamy and rich filling.
    • Spinach: Fresh, roughly 1 cup, for a healthy touch and vibrant color.
    • Bell Peppers: 1 or 2, diced, for sweetness and crunch. Choose red, yellow, or green.
    • Garlic: 2 to 3 cloves, minced, to enhance flavor.
    • Seasoning: Salt and pepper to taste, plus optional spices like paprika or Italian seasoning for extra flavor.

    Preparation Steps

    Preparing beef pinwheels requires a few simple steps to ensure the process is smooth and efficient. Follow these instructions for a delicious result.

    Preparing the Beef

    1. Select the Meat: Choose thinly sliced flank steak or sirloin for the best results. These cuts roll easily and cook evenly.
    2. Pound the Beef: Use a meat mallet to gently pound the beef slices to about ¼ inch thick. Thinner slices enhance rolling and tenderness.
    3. Season Generously: Sprinkle salt, pepper, and any preferred seasoning over both sides of the meat to enhance the flavor.
    1. Spread the Filling: Evenly spread a layer of cream cheese over each beef slice, leaving edges uncovered.
    2. Add Vegetables: Layer fresh spinach and diced bell peppers on top of the cream cheese. Minced garlic adds an additional flavor boost.
    3. Roll Tightly: Starting from one end, carefully roll the beef slice toward the other end, ensuring the filling stays inside. Secure with toothpicks to hold the shape.
    4. Cut into Sections: Slice the rolled beef into 1-inch pinwheels. This size is ideal for cooking and serving.

    These preparation steps set the stage for your beef pinwheels, allowing them to shine at any gathering or meal.

    1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
    2. Prepare a baking sheet by lining it with parchment paper or greasing it lightly.
    3. Place the pinwheels on the baking sheet, ensuring they’re spaced evenly.
    4.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the beef is cooked through, reaching an internal temperature of 145°F (63°C).
    5. Broil for an additional 2-3 minutes for extra browning if desired.

    Baking provides a gentle heat that helps melt the filling ingredients, creating a delicious contrast of flavors. Consider using a meat thermometer for precise cooking.

    Grilling Beef Pinwheels

    Grilling gives beef pinwheels a smoky flavor and charred texture.

    1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
    2. Oil the grill grates lightly to prevent sticking.
    3. Place pinwheels on the grill and close the lid.
    4. Cook for about 5-7 minutes on each side, monitoring closely until they reach the desired doneness. The internal temperature should hit 145°F (63°C).
    5. Remove from the grill and let them rest for 5 minutes before slicing.

    Grilling adds a rich, smoky taste perfect for outdoor gatherings. For extra flavor, marinate the beef with your favorite spices or sauces prior to grilling.

    Choose either method based on your preference for texture and flavor.

    Roll Tightly

    Roll the beef tightly to keep the filling secure. Tight rolls ensure that the filling doesn’t spill out during cooking.

    Secure with Toothpicks

    Use toothpicks to hold the pinwheels together. This simple step prevents them from unraveling while cooking.

    Maintain Uniform Thickness

    Slice the pinwheels into 1-inch pieces. This size promotes even cooking and creates visually appealing bites.

    Preheat Your Cooking Surface

    Always preheat your grill, oven, or skillet. This ensures that the pinwheels cook evenly and develop a nice crust.

    Monitor Cooking Time

    Cook the pinwheels for the recommended time based on your method. Bake for 20-25 minutes at 400°F (200°C) or grill for 5-7 minutes per side.

    Let Rest Before Serving

    Allow the pinwheels to rest for a few minutes after cooking. Resting helps the juices redistribute, making each bite more flavorful.
